Honda Passport LX

Produced from 1998 to 2002, the Passport LX was the second generation model of the Honda Passport. This model was one of the two trim levels of the Passport, along with the upscale EX.

How do you remove a flat tire from a 1999 Honda Passport?

The jack is located on the left rear side of the cargo area - behind a small door. The tools to use the jack and the lug wrench are under the rear seats. Jacking points are identified in the users manual. Once they are located, then removal of the tire is like all other cars - except the wheel/tire combination is much heavier.

Where is the transmission dipstick located on a 1999 Honda Passport?

Just had it done on my Passport. There is no dipstick, there is an "overfill screw" in the bottom of the transmission, just above the drain plug. You don't need any special tool, but you do need to get it into a shop or put it up on the hoist in order to be able to measure it properly.

If you are planning to replace the transmission oil, here are the steps you need to follow:

-Drain the old fluid through drain plug.

-Using the vacuum pump, pump about 6-7 quarts of Dextron III into the overfill screw hole until it's starting to pour out on you.

-Let the excess fluid drain out, then close the screw.

-Start the car in Park

-Move the Transmission Shifter through all gears (keep it in each gear for a few seconds) then put it back into park.

-Let the engine idle for 3 minutes, then shut it off

-Not that the trans fluid is nice and warm you can unscrew the overfill plug again and check the fluid level, it should be to the top of that overfill level.

Where is the flasher relay on a 1995 Honda Passport?

The flasher is located on the left side of the Driver kicker panel. It is behind the vent and speaker grill of the dash. Very difficult to locate and get to. It has a clip that needs to be pried upwards to relase the relay.

What causes error code po446 in a 1996 Honda Passport?

Error code P0446 in a 1996 Honda Passport indicates a problem with the evaporative emission control system (EVAP), specifically related to the vent control circuit. This could be caused by a clogged or faulty EVAP vent valve, a damaged or disconnected vacuum line, or an issue with the engine control module (ECM). Additionally, a loose or damaged gas cap can also trigger this code. It's important to diagnose the specific component causing the issue for proper repairs.

How do you put Freon on Honda passport?

To add Freon to a Honda Passport, first locate the low-pressure service port, usually found on the larger of the two AC lines. Attach a refrigerant gauge or canister to the port, ensuring it's securely connected. Start the engine and turn the AC to the maximum setting, then gradually add Freon until the system reaches the proper pressure as indicated on the gauge. Always follow safety precautions and check for leaks after recharging the system.
